Chen Hu in Ohio, USA

We found 1 person named Chen Hu in Ohio. View Chen’s phone numbers, current address, previous addresses, emails, family members, neighbors and associates.

Filter
Browse by State
Browse by City
Lebanon, OH
Current & Previous Addresses

3766 Normandy Ct, Lebanon, OH, 45036 (current address)

Birth, Death, and Divorce Records for Chen Hu

Sponsored by Ancestry.com

Chen Hu, Q&A

Frequently asked questions for Chen Hu

Chen Hu currently lives at 3766 Normandy Ct, Lebanon, Ohio, 45036 and has been living at this address since 2019.